Answers About the Augustana Printing Policy

Why does the college keep track of how much users print?

To be environmentally sustainable and to encourage good stewardship of paper, toner, and electricity resources.

How was this policy developed?

Over the course of several years in discussion with the Dean of Students, SGA representation, ITS, the library director, the Campus Sustainability Committee, and the Academic Computing Committee.

Do other schools do this?

Yes, the vast majority that we surveyed have similar or more restrictive printing policies.

What if I need to print for my club, for my department, or other reasons not for myself?

Printing needs for clubs or departments should be budgeted for in advance and processed through the college's Copy Center in Sorensen, and billed to the appropriate account number.

Departmental printing to a laser printer should be printed from a departmental account, not personal student accounts.

How do I check my printing balance level?

Login with your Augustana username and password to http://printing.augustana.edu to view your balance. You will be notified by e-mail when your balance drops below $10.00. Top-up cards are available for $5.00 at the bookstore and the library.

How do I add credit?

Using a card purchased at the library or bookstore, log in to http://printing.augustana.edu with your username and password, and click on "Redeem Card" on the left side. Enter the code found on the card and your account will be incremented by $5.

How much can I print with my annual $100 printing credit or with a $5 recharge card?

Printer Type Cost per page Pages available for annual $100 credit Pages available for $5 recharge card
Black and white, duplex, (2 pages to a sheet of paper) $0.04 2500 125
Black and white, one side $0.06 1666 83
Color, duplex $0.20 500 25
Color, single sided $0.25 400 20
